Transaction 65c827263fdead6d2f2e320e50e2a6b643ca8b5fb408a211ecac23feae66fe07

1 Input
2 Outputs
  • 65c827263fdead6d2f2e320e50e2a6b643ca8b5fb408a211ecac23feae66fe07:0
  • value  127768
    address  1HQKuUHRctYHjWPJ18WtGSjT95r7aB565a
  • 65c827263fdead6d2f2e320e50e2a6b643ca8b5fb408a211ecac23feae66fe07:1
  • value  15507742
    address  3MD82vLHKgzN21EMqxNMANFrC9aCLxvgzS